Aaron Rodgers: Matchup with Joe Flacco is great for the old guys

Yahoo SportsWednesday, October 15, 2025 at 8:25:45 AM
PositiveSports
Aaron Rodgers and Joe Flacco are set to make history as just the second pair of quarterbacks over 40 to start against each other in an NFL game. This matchup not only highlights the longevity and resilience of these seasoned players but also brings a nostalgic element to the game, showcasing their experience and skill. Fans are excited to see how these veterans will perform, proving that age is just a number in the competitive world of football.
